worktile
-
go语言是什么语言写的
Go语言,又称Golang,是由Google公司开发的一种静态类型、编译型语言,主要由C语言编写。它结合了C语言的性能优势和Python语言的易用性,旨在提高编程效率和代码的可读性。1、Go语言的设计初衷;2、Go语言的编译器和运行时库;3、Go语言的生态系统。下面将详细解释Go语言的编译器和运行时…
-
go语言源码为什么也是go
Go语言的源码也是用Go语言编写的。这种设计选择背后有几个重要原因:1、自举特性,2、优化自身语言的性能和功能,3、增强开发者信心。其中,自举特性是一个关键因素,它指的是编程语言可以用自己编写编译器或解释器,这不仅是对语言能力的验证,也有助于持续改进和优化语言本身。 一、自举特性 自举特性指的是一种…
-
什么语言代替go
在当前技术栈中,有几种语言可以替代Go语言,具体取决于你的需求和项目特点。1、Rust、2、Python、3、Java、4、Node.js、5、C++。其中Rust因其高性能和内存安全性,越来越受到开发者的青睐。Rust 通过所有权系统来管理内存,可以避免很多常见的错误。此外,Rust 还提供了强大…
-
go语言像什么
Go语言像什么?1、像C语言,2、像Python语言,3、像Java语言,4、像JavaScript语言。其中,Go语言最像C语言,因为它的语法和编译过程都深受C语言的影响。Go语言的设计初衷之一就是提供一种高效、简洁的编程体验,这与C语言的设计理念非常相似。Go语言的编译速度非常快,接近于C语言,…
-
go像什么语言
Go语言(也称为Golang)在语法和设计理念上类似于多种编程语言。1、C语言、2、Python、3、Java、4、JavaScript。其中,Go语言的语法最接近C语言,并且继承了C语言的简洁和高效。接下来,我们将详细探讨Go语言与C语言的相似之处。 一、C语言 Go语言的语法结构和C语言非常相似…
-
go 语言最适合做什么
Go语言最适合用于1、构建高并发系统,2、开发微服务架构,3、处理大规模数据处理任务,4、创建网络服务器,5、开发云原生应用。在这些应用中,Go语言的简单性、高效性和强大的并发处理能力使其成为开发者的首选。 其中,构建高并发系统值得特别关注。Go语言通过其独特的协程(goroutines)和通道(c…
-
go语言主要做什么业务
Go语言,常被称为Golang,是由谷歌开发的一种静态强类型、编译型语言,主要用于以下几个业务领域:1、服务器端开发,2、云计算和分布式系统,3、微服务架构,4、网络编程,5、数据处理和分析。其中,Go语言在服务器端开发中表现尤为突出,因其高并发处理能力和简单易学的语法,使得开发者能够更高效地构建和…
-
go语言开发是做什么的
Go语言开发主要是用于1、构建高效的服务器端应用程序,2、开发分布式系统,3、处理高并发任务,4、构建微服务架构,5、开发云计算和容器化应用。其中,Go语言在构建高效的服务器端应用程序方面表现尤为突出。Go语言的设计初衷就是为了提高开发效率和运行性能,尤其是在处理大量并发请求时表现优异。它的内置并发…
-
go语言用什么编码打开
在Go语言中,通常使用UTF-8编码来处理文本文件。这是因为UTF-8是一种广泛使用的字符编码,它兼容ASCII编码并且能够表示几乎所有书写系统的字符。1、UTF-8编码是Go语言的默认编码,2、标准库提供了对其他编码的支持,3、使用第三方库也可以处理其他编码格式。下面将详细讨论第一点。 UTF-8…
-
go语言中有什么函数
Go语言中有许多函数,涵盖了基础功能、字符串操作、时间处理等多方面。1、内置函数、2、标准库函数、3、自定义函数是最常用的几类函数。下面将详细讨论内置函数,并简要介绍标准库函数和自定义函数。 一、内置函数 Go语言提供了一些内置函数,这些函数在所有包中都可以直接调用,无需引入特定的包。常见的内置函数…